Question
`(3 - sqrt(5))(2 - sqrt(5))` is ______.
Options
rational
irrational
1
11

Solution
`(3 - sqrt(5))(2 - sqrt(5))` is irrational.
Explanation:
Let’s re-evaluate carefully:
`(3 - sqrt(5))(2 - sqrt(5))`
Using the distributive property (FOIL):
= `3 xx 2 - 3sqrt(5) - 2sqrt(5) + sqrt(5) xx sqrt(5)`
= `6 - 3sqrt(5) - 2sqrt(5) + 5`
= `(6 + 5) - 5sqrt(5)`
= `11 - 5sqrt(5)`
This expression contains the irrational term `sqrt(5)`, so it is irrational.
